@@ -5,10 +5,477 @@ All notable changes to **Pipecat** will be documented in this file.
The format is based on [Keep a Changelog](https://keepachangelog.com/en/1.0.0/),
and this project adheres to [Semantic Versioning](https://semver.org/spec/v2.0.0.html).
## [Unreleased]
## [0.0.68] - 2025-05-28
### Added
- Added `GoogleHttpTTSService` which uses Google's HTTP TTS API.
- Added `TavusTransport`, a new transport implementation compatible with any
Pipecat pipeline. When using the `TavusTransport`the Pipecat bot will
connect in the same room as the Tavus Avatar and the user.
- Added `PlivoFrameSerializer` to support Plivo calls. A full running example
has also been added to `examples/plivo-chatbot`.
- Added `UserBotLatencyLogObserver`. This is an observer that logs the latency
between when the user stops speaking and when the bot starts speaking. This
gives you an initial idea on how quickly the AI services respond.
- Added `SarvamTTSService`, which implements Sarvam AI's TTS API:
https://docs.sarvam.ai/api-reference-docs/text-to-speech/convert.
- Added `PipelineTask.add_observer()` and `PipelineTask.remove_observer()` to
allow mangaging observers at runtime. This is useful for cases where the task
is passed around to other code components that might want to observe the
pipeline dynamically.
- Added `user_id` field to `TranscriptionMessage`. This allows identifying the
user in a multi-user scenario. Note that this requires that
`TranscriptionFrame` has the `user_id` properly set.
- Added new `PipelineTask` event handlers `on_pipeline_started`,
`on_pipeline_stopped`, `on_pipeline_ended` and `on_pipeline_cancelled`, which
correspond to the `StartFrame`, `StopFrame`, `EndFrame` and `CancelFrame`
respectively.
- Added additional languages to `LmntTTSService`. Languages include: `hi`,
`id`, `it`, `ja`, `nl`, `pl`, `ru`, `sv`, `th`, `tr`, `uk`, `vi`.
- Added a `model` parameter to the `LmntTTSService` constructor, allowing
switching between LMNT models.
- Added `MiniMaxHttpTTSService`, which implements MiniMax's T2A API for TTS.
Learn more: https://www.minimax.io/platform_overview
- A new function `FrameProcessor.setup()` has been added to allow setting up
frame processors before receiving a `StartFrame`. This is what's happening
internally: `FrameProcessor.setup()` is called, `StartFrame` is pushed from
the beginning of the pipeline, your regular pipeline operations, `EndFrame`
or `CancelFrame` are pushed from the beginning of the pipeline and finally
`FrameProcessor.cleanup()` is called.
- Added support for OpenTelemetry tracing in Pipecat. This initial
implementation includes:
- A `setup_tracing` method where you can specify your OpenTelemetry exporter
- Service decorators for STT (`@traced_stt`), LLM (`@traced_llm`), and TTS
(`@traced_tts`) which trace the execution and collect properties and
metrics (TTFB, token usage, character counts, etc.)
- Class decorators that provide execution tracking; these are generic and can
be used for service tracking as needed
- Spans that help track traces on a per conversations and turn basis:

By default, Pipecat has implemented service decorators to trace execution of
STT, LLM, and TTS services. You can enable tracing by setting
`enable_tracing` to `True` in the PipelineTask.
- Added `TurnTrackingObserver`, which tracks the start and end of a user/bot
turn pair and emits events `on_turn_started` and `on_turn_stopped`
corresponding to the start and end of a turn, respectively.
- Allow passing observers to `run_test()` while running unit tests.
### Changed
- Upgraded `daily-python` to 0.19.1.
- ⚠️ Updated `SmallWebRTCTransport` to align with how other transports handle
`on_client_disconnected`. Now, when the connection is closed and no reconnection
is attempted, `on_client_disconnected` is called instead of `on_client_close`. The
`on_client_close` callback is no longer used, use `on_client_disconnected` instead.
- Check if `PipelineTask` has already been cancelled.
- Don't raise an exception if event handler is not registered.
- Upgraded `deepgram-sdk` to 4.1.0.
- Updated `GoogleTTSService` to use Google's streaming TTS API. The default
voice also updated to `en-US-Chirp3-HD-Charon`.
- ⚠️ Refactored the `TavusVideoService`, so it acts like a proxy, sending audio
to Tavus and receiving both audio and video. This will make
`TavusVideoService` usable with any Pipecat pipeline and with any transport.
This is a **breaking change**, check the
`examples/foundational/21a-tavus-layer-small-webrtc.py` to see how to use it.
- `DailyTransport` now uses custom microphone audio tracks instead of virtual
microphones. Now, multiple Daily transports can be used in the same process.
- `DailyTransport` now captures audio from individual participants instead of
the whole room. This allows identifying audio frames per participant.
- Updated the default model for `AnthropicLLMService` to
`claude-sonnet-4-20250514`.
- Updated the default model for `GeminiMultimodalLiveLLMService` to
`models/gemini-2.5-flash-preview-native-audio-dialog`.
- `BaseTextFilter` methods `filter()`, `update_settings()`,
`handle_interruption()` and `reset_interruption()` are now async.
- `BaseTextAggregator` methods `aggregate()`, `handle_interruption()` and
`reset()` are now async.
- The API version for `CartesiaTTSService` and `CartesiaHttpTTSService` has
been updated. Also, the `cartesia` dependency has been updated to 2.x.
- `CartesiaTTSService` and `CartesiaHttpTTSService` now support Cartesia's new
`speed` parameter which accepts values of `slow`, `normal`, and `fast`.
- `GeminiMultimodalLiveLLMService` now uses the user transcription and usage
metrics provided by Gemini Live.
- `GoogleLLMService` has been updated to use `google-genai` instead of the
deprecated `google-generativeai`.
### Deprecated
- In `CartesiaTTSService` and `CartesiaHttpTTSService`, `emotion` has been
deprecated by Cartesia. Pipecat is following suit and deprecating `emotion`
as well.
### Removed
- Since `GeminiMultimodalLiveLLMService` now transcribes it's own audio, the
`transcribe_user_audio` arg has been removed. Audio is now transcribed
automatically.
- Removed `SileroVAD` frame processor, just use `SileroVADAnalyzer`
instead. Also removed, `07a-interruptible-vad.py` example.
### Fixed
- Fixed a `DailyTransport` issue that was not allow capturing video frames if
framerate was greater than zero.
- Fixed a `DeegramSTTService` connection issue when the user provided their own
`LiveOptions`.
- Fixed a `DailyTransport` issue that would cause images needing resize to block
the event loop.
- Fixed an issue with `ElevenLabsTTSService` where changing the model or voice
while the service is running wasn't working.
- Fixed an issue that would cause multiple instances of the same class to behave
incorrectly if any of the given constructor arguments defaulted to a mutable
value (e.g. lists, dictionaries, objects).
- Fixed an issue with `CartesiaTTSService` where `TTSTextFrame` messages weren't
being emitted when the model was set to `sonic`. This resulted in the
assistant context not being updated with assistant messages.
### Performance
- `DailyTransport`: process audio, video and events in separate tasks.
- Don't create event handler tasks if no user event handlers have been
registered.
### Other
- It is now possible to run all (or most) foundational example with multiple
transports. By default, they run with P2P (Peer-To-Peer) WebRTC so you can try
everything locally. You can also run them with Daily or even with a Twilio
phone number.
- Added foundation examples `07y-interruptible-minimax.py` and
`07z-interruptible-sarvam.py`to show how to use the `MiniMaxHttpTTSService`
and `SarvamTTSService`, respectively.
- Added an `open-telemetry-tracing` example, showing how to setup tracing. The
example also includes Jaeger as an open source OpenTelemetry client to review
traces from the example runs.
- Added foundational example `29-turn-tracking-observer.py` to show how to use
the `TurnTrackingObserver`.
## [0.0.67] - 2025-05-07
### Added
- Added `DebugLogObserver` for detailed frame logging with configurable
filtering by frame type and endpoint. This observer automatically extracts
and formats all frame data fields for debug logging.
- `UserImageRequestFrame.video_source` field has been added to request an image
from the desired video source.
- Added support for the AWS Nova Sonic speech-to-speech model with the new
`AWSNovaSonicLLMService`.
See https://docs.aws.amazon.com/nova/latest/userguide/speech.html.
Note that it requires Python >= 3.12 and `pip install pipecat-ai[aws-nova-sonic]`.
- Added new AWS services `AWSBedrockLLMService` and `AWSTranscribeSTTService`.
- Added `on_active_speaker_changed` event handler to the `DailyTransport` class.
- Added `enable_ssml_parsing` and `enable_logging` to `InputParams` in
`ElevenLabsTTSService`.
- Added support to `RimeHttpTTSService` for the `arcana` model.
### Changed
- Updated `ElevenLabsTTSService` to use the beta websocket API
(multi-stream-input). This new API supports context_ids and cancelling those
contexts, which greatly improves interruption handling.
- Observers `on_push_frame()` now take a single argument `FramePushed` instead
of multiple arguments.
- Updated the default voice for `DeepgramTTSService` to `aura-2-helena-en`.
### Deprecated
- `PollyTTSService` is now deprecated, use `AWSPollyTTSService` instead.
- Observer `on_push_frame(src, dst, frame, direction, timestamp)` is now
deprecated, use `on_push_frame(data: FramePushed)` instead.
### Fixed
- Fixed a `DailyTransport` issue that was causing issues when multiple audio or
video sources where being captured.
- Fixed a `UltravoxSTTService` issue that would cause the service to generate
all tokens as one word.
- Fixed a `PipelineTask` issue that would cause tasks to not be cancelled if
task was cancelled from outside of Pipecat.
- Fixed a `TaskManager` that was causing dangling tasks to be reported.
- Fixed an issue that could cause data to be sent to the transports when they
were still not ready.
- Remove custom audio tracks from `DailyTransport` before leaving.
### Removed
- Removed `CanonicalMetricsService` as it's no longer maintained.
## [0.0.66] - 2025-05-02
### Added
- Added two new input parameters to `RimeTTSService`: `pause_between_brackets`
and `phonemize_between_brackets`.
- Added support for cross-platform local smart turn detection. You can use
`LocalSmartTurnAnalyzer` for on-device inference using Torch.
- `BaseOutputTransport` now allows multiple destinations if the transport
implementation supports it (e.g. Daily's custom tracks). With multiple
destinations it is possible to send different audio or video tracks with a
single transport simultaneously. To do that, you need to set the new
`Frame.transport_destination` field with your desired transport destination
(e.g. custom track name), tell the transport you want a new destination with
`TransportParams.audio_out_destinations` or
`TransportParams.video_out_destinations` and the transport should take care of
the rest.
- Similar to the new `Frame.transport_destination`, there's a new
`Frame.transport_source` field which is set by the `BaseInputTransport` if the
incoming data comes from a non-default source (e.g. custom tracks).
- `TTSService` has a new `transport_destination` constructor parameter. This
parameter will be used to update the `Frame.transport_destination` field for
each generated `TTSAudioRawFrame`. This allows sending multiple bots' audio to
multiple destinations in the same pipeline.
- Added `DailyTransportParams.camera_out_enabled` and
`DailyTransportParams.microphone_out_enabled` which allows you to
enable/disable the main output camera or microphone tracks. This is useful if
you only want to use custom tracks and not send the main tracks. Note that you
still need `audio_out_enabled=True` or `video_out_enabled`.
- Added `DailyTransport.capture_participant_audio()` which allows you to capture
an audio source (e.g. "microphone", "screenAudio" or a custom track name) from
a remote participant.
- Added `DailyTransport.update_publishing()` which allows you to update the call
video and audio publishing settings (e.g. audio and video quality).
- Added `RTVIObserverParams` which allows you to configure what RTVI messages
are sent to the clients.
- Added a `context_window_compression` InputParam to
`GeminiMultimodalLiveLLMService` which allows you to enable a sliding context
window for the session as well as set the token limit of the sliding window.
- Updated `SmallWebRTCConnection` to support `ice_servers` with credentials.
- Added `VADUserStartedSpeakingFrame` and `VADUserStoppedSpeakingFrame`,
indicating when the VAD detected the user to start and stop speaking. These
events are helpful when using smart turn detection, as the user's stop time
can differ from when their turn ends (signified by UserStoppedSpeakingFrame).
- Added `TranslationFrame`, a new frame type that contains a translated
transcription.
- Added `TransportParams.audio_in_passthrough`. If set (the default), incoming
audio will be pushed downstream.
- Added `MCPClient`; a way to connect to MCP servers and use the MCP servers'
tools.
- Added `Mem0 OSS`, along with Mem0 cloud support now the OSS version is also
available.
### Changed

- The `STTMuteFilter` now mutes `InterimTranscriptionFrame` and
`TranscriptionFrame` which allows the `STTMuteFilter` to be used in
conjunction with transports that generate transcripts, e.g. `DailyTransport`.
- Function calls now receive a single parameter `FunctionCallParams` instead of
`(function_name, tool_call_id, args, llm, context, result_callback)` which is
now deprecated.
- Changed the user aggregator timeout for late transcriptions from 1.0s to 0.5s
(`LLMUserAggregatorParams.aggregation_timeout`). Sometimes, the STT services
might give us more than one transcription which could come after the user
stopped speaking. We still want to include these additional transcriptions
with the first one because it's part of the user turn. This is what this
timeout is helpful with.
- Short utterances not detected by VAD while the bot is speaking are now
ignored. This reduces the amount of bot interruptions significantly providing
a more natural conversation experience.
- Updated `GladiaSTTService` to output a `TranslationFrame` when specifying a
`translation` and `translation_config`.
- STT services now passthrough audio frames by default. This allows you to add
audio recording without worrying about what's wrong in your pipeline when it
doesn't work the first time.
- Input transports now always push audio downstream unless disabled with
`TransportParams.audio_in_passthrough`. After many Pipecat releases, we
realized this is the common use case. There are use cases where the input
transport already provides STT and you also don't want recordings, in which
case there's no need to push audio to the rest of the pipeline, but this is
not a very common case.
- Added `RivaSegmentedSTTService`, which allows Riva offline/batch models, such
as to be "canary-1b-asr" used in Pipecat.
### Deprecated
- Function calls with parameters
`(function_name, tool_call_id, args, llm, context, result_callback)` are
deprectated, use a single `FunctionCallParams` parameter instead.
- `TransportParams.camera_*` parameters are now deprecated, use
`TransportParams.video_*` instead.
- `TransportParams.vad_enabled` parameter is now deprecated, use
`TransportParams.audio_in_enabled` and `TransportParams.vad_analyzer` instead.
- `TransportParams.vad_audio_passthrough` parameter is now deprecated, use
`TransportParams.audio_in_passthrough` instead.
- `ParakeetSTTService` is now deprecated, use `RivaSTTService` instead, which uses
the model "parakeet-ctc-1.1b-asr" by default.
- `FastPitchTTSService` is now deprecated, use `RivaTTSService` instead, which uses
the model "magpie-tts-multilingual" by default.
### Fixed
- Fixed an issue with `SimliVideoService` where the bot was continuously outputting
audio, which prevents the `BotStoppedSpeakingFrame` from being emitted.
- Fixed an issue where `OpenAIRealtimeBetaLLMService` would add two assistant
messages to the context.
- Fixed an issue with `GeminiMultimodalLiveLLMService` where the context
contained tokens instead of words.
- Fixed an issue with HTTP Smart Turn handling, where the service returns a 500
error. Previously, this would cause an unhandled exception. Now, a 500 error
is treated as an incomplete response.
- Fixed a TTS services issue that could cause assistant output not to be
aggregated to the context when also using `TTSSpeakFrame`s.
- Fixed an issue where the `SmartTurnMetricsData` was reporting 0ms for
inference and processing time when using the `FalSmartTurnAnalyzer`.
### Other
- Added `examples/daily-custom-tracks` to show how to send and receive Daily
custom tracks.
- Added `examples/daily-multi-translation` to showcase how to send multiple
simulataneous translations with the same transport.
- Added 04 foundational examples for client/server transports. Also, renamed
`29-livekit-audio-chat.py` to `04b-transports-livekit.py`.
- Added foundational example `13c-gladia-translation.py` showing how to use
`TranscriptionFrame` and `TranslationFrame`.

# Modal + Pipecat Tips
- In most other Pipecat examples, we use `Popen` to launch the pipeline process from the `/connect` endpoint. In this example, we use a Modal function instead. This allows us to run the pipelines using a separately defined Modal image as well as run each pipeline in an isolated container.
- For the FastAPI and most common Pipecat Pipeline containers, a default `debian_slim` CPU-only should be all that's required to run. GPU containers are needed for self-hosted services.
- To minimize cold starts of the pipeline and reduce latency for users, set `min_containers=1` on the Modal Function that launches the pipeline to ensure at least one warm instance of your function is always available.
- For next steps on running a self-hosted llm and reducing latency, check out all of [Modal's LLM examples](https://modal.com/docs/examples/vllm_inference).

# Smart Turn Detection Demo
This demo showcases Pipecat's Smart Turn Detection feature - an advanced conversational turn detection system that uses machine learning to identify when a speaker has finished their turn in a conversation. Unlike basic Voice Activity Detection (VAD) which only detects speech vs. silence, Smart Turn detects natural conversational cues like intonation patterns, pacing, and linguistic signals.
This demo uses the [pipecat-ai/smart-turn](https://huggingface.co/pipecat-ai/smart-turn) model - an open-source, community-driven conversational turn detection model designed to provide more natural turn-taking in voice interactions. The model is being hosted on Fal's infrastructure for GPU acceleration, offering inference times between 50-60ms.
In the client UI, you can see the transcription messages along with the smart-turn model's prediction results in real-time.
